java.awt.Robot

CZCC

Mitglied
Hallo

ich habe mir folgendes Script zusammengebastelt
Java:
import java.awt.Robot;
 
public class start {
	public static void main(String[] args) throws AWTException {
		
		Robot rob = new Robot();
		rob.mouseMove(100, 100);
	}
}
es funktioniert einwandfrei nun möchte ich das wen die maus dort ist die linke rechte maustaste gedrückt wird. Dazu verwendet man ja
Java:
		rob.mousePress(InputEvent.BUTTON1_MASK);
allerdings funktioniert dies net. Kann wir da vieleicht einer sagen warum.

Gruß
CZCC
 
Versuch mal nen
Java:
rob.mouseRelease(InputEvent.BUTTON1_MASK);
nach deinem mousePress().
Damit simulierst du dann eine art Klick. Normalerweise sind Buttons u.ä. so programmiert, dass die nur auf eine Folge von down und up (also einem klick) reagieren.

MfG
Daniel
 
Zurück